Exciting Partnership Announcement: EECF Welcomes New Fundholder

We are delighted to share the exciting news of a new charitable fund under management.  The CWG Grants Programme, which re-launched in February 2024, marks a significant opportunity for local voluntary organisations in Tower Hamlets to access vital funding, with grants of up to £10,000.

Tracey Walsh, EECF’s Chief Executive said: “We are incredibly pleased to welcome CWG as a fundholder. The fund demonstrates their commitment to invest in local grassroots organisations.  They are a great example of a purpose-led company committed to supporting the communities on their doorstep.”

Committed to creating a positive and lasting impact that goes beyond the buildings and places it creates, CWG’s generous £300,000 fund, which is aligned with the firm’s social value approach, is focused on three core themes; Education, Skills and Employment, and Wellbeing and Biodiversity. 

Describing the motivation for CWG to outsource the management of its charitable fund, Jane Hollinshead, Chief People Officer said:

“We are pleased to be partnering with EECF to deliver the CWG Community Grant Programme, their reputation locally as a trusted, knowledgeable and well respected grant maker will assist us in ensuring our grants can support those organisations in Tower Hamlets who need it the most, making a positive and lasting impact”.
